In what ways can actively seeking out negative feedback from others help individuals build resilience and adaptability in the face of challenges and setbacks in their personal and professional lives?
Actively seeking out negative feedback allows individuals to identify areas for improvement and growth, leading to increased self-awareness and self-improvement. By receiving constructive criticism, individuals can develop the ability to handle criticism and setbacks more effectively, ultimately building resilience and adaptability. Embracing negative feedback as an opportunity for growth can help individuals develop a growth mindset and learn from their mistakes, leading to greater success in both personal and professional endeavors.
